Box Score CAMDEN, N.J. - The TCNJ men's soccer team wrapped up their 2022 season on Wednesday night, falling by a final score of 3-0 to Rutgers-Camden.
Â
Right when it seemed that the matchup would be scoreless at half, the Scarlet Raptors netted the first goal of the game with just 59 seconds remaining in the period. After a TCNJ foul just outside the box, a free kick that bent around the Lions wall found its way into the bottom right corner of the net.

The Lions (7-10-1, 2-7) applied pressure in the first period with five shots on goal, but were not able to tie the game before half.

Massimo Rodio had a great chance to tie the game early in the second half on a shot from just inside the box. He made a move to his right and sent a strike that was on its way to the top right corner when the Rutgers-Camden goalkeeper stuck his hand in the air and sent the ball off target.

After this golden opportunity, the Scarlet Raptors tacked on two more goals and held the Lions scoreless for the remainder of the second, securing the 3-0 victory.

Rodio,
Luke Pascarella and
Ryan Phillips all logged shots on goal for TCNJ. Rodio had three while Pascarella had two and Phillps one.
